Metalbone HRD 3.2

🔔 Review of 2024 model: Metalbone HRD+.

One of the most sought after rackets on the market due to the player it is associated with, the updated Metalbone 3.2 is a mostly cosmetic update to last year’s version of Alejandro Galan’s signature racket.

With a medium-hard touch and a small sweet spot, this is a technical oversized diamond racket.

2023’s Spin Blade system transmits less spin than the previous versions.
